titleOfInvention | Production method of walnut diaphragma juglandis tea |
abstract | The invention discloses a production method of walnut diaphragma juglandis tea, and belongs to the technical field of health food processing. The weight parts of the traditional Chinese medicinal materials are as follows: 10-15 parts of diaphragma juglandis, 1.2-1.5 parts of astragalus, 0.8-1.0 part of liquorice, 0.5-0.9 part of American ginseng, 0.5-0.6 part of angelica, 0.6-0.9 part of orange peel, 0.6-0.9 part of cimicifuga foetida, 0.7-0.9 part of bighead atractylodes rhizome, 0.4-0.5 part of ginger, 0.5-1.0 part of Chinese date and 0.5-1.0 part of medlar. The preparation method comprises processing the above Chinese medicinal materials with yellow wine, processing with bran, drying, and packaging to obtain diaphragma juglandis fructus product sheet tea; the processed traditional Chinese medicinal materials are subjected to ultrasonic extraction, filtration, vacuum concentration, spray drying and packaging to obtain the finished product of the diaphragma juglandis instant tea. The walnut diaphragma juglandis tea produced by the invention has the total flavone content of 7.16-16.36 percent and the polysaccharide content of 6.46-12.12 percent, has obvious effects on clinical verification of dizziness, tiredness, waist soreness, leg pain and nocturia caused by kidney deficiency and aging, has no toxic or side effect, and is wide in applicable population. |
